New Intercity Fleet Maintenance Facility
SMEC was engaged by the John Holland Group (JHG) as the lead engineering consultant to provide engineering design services for the new Intercity Fleet Maintenance Facility. SMEC applied innovative design solutions that enabled the construction of heavy-duty foundations to support the train maintenance building and bridge abutments.
